Anthony Caruso (April 7, 1916 – April 4, 2003) was an American character actor in more than one hundred American films, usually playing villains and gangsters, including the first season of Walt Disneys Zorro as Captain Juan Ortega.

Paul De Rolf was an American actor, choreographer, and dancer. In addition to his acting credits, De Rolf choreographed Steven Spielbergs 1941 and The Karate Kid Part II, as well as the television series Petticoat Junction and The Beverly Hillbillies. De Rolf began his career as a child actor.
